The signature campaign is an initiative of building owner Manette Baggen, the residents’ organization Rivierenbuurt in Groningen and the makers of the artwork.

Municipality wants mural removed
The municipality of Groningen, which itself asked Baggen to make the wall available for a work of art, wants the mural to be removed within a year. According to her, the wall belongs to a monumental building. The municipality only found out after RTV Noord reported about the project.

That got things rolling. The municipal department, which is responsible for permits, investigated and came to the conclusion that the building on the corner of Vechtstraat and Hereweg cannot simply be painted.

According to Baggen, the wall is not part of the monumental building and was attached to it in the 1960s. Like local residents, she is happy with the mural and wants it to be legalized.
